The drive for Next-Generation Platforms – namely the Future Combat Air System (FCAS), Main Ground Combat System (MGCS) and Eurodrone – arises from NATO’s and the EU’s determination to retain a decisive technological edge over potential adversaries. After 2014, and especially following Russia’s full-scale invasion of Ukraine in 2022, Allied leaders became acutely aware that many Western legacy platforms (from fourth-generation fighter jets to Cold War-era tanks and unarmed drones) could struggle against the modern anti-access and high-tech capabilities being fielded by peer competitors.
